Oxford Attack Major Bantam Boys kicked off new season over the weekend against London.
LONDON – The season is now officially underway for the Oxford Attack Major Bantam Boys basketball team.
The U14 squad has been practicing together since early October and has been gearing up for their first competition against the London Gold Medal club.
Some early mistakes, missed defensive assignments and first-game jitters resulted in a 41-27 loss for Oxford.
Many of the Attack players are returning from last year, a little bigger and with a season of experience.
Ending last year with a Provincial silver medal and adding a few new players to this year’s roster, some good things are expected. The loss to Gold Medal was a good reminder of what it takes to play at this level.
Centre, Justin Chisholm, lead all scorers with 11 points.
Next up for the Attack boys is a match with a team from Huron County on December 11th at Huron Park Secondary School.
